One of my hens went blind in one eye a while back now and she's adjusted as well as a half blind hen can but on her blind side by her tail feathers is a patch of under fluff but the rest of the feathers in that patch are gone. I thought it was my aggressive roo at first but he's been gone for almost a month now I think and it hasn't gotten any better. I'm starting to wonder if she's over grooming that spot because she can't see it. And if she is, is there something I can do to stop that? I unfortunately don't think a saddle would be a good idea either, it gets very hot here and she's already black. I don't want to overheat her even more just to get her to stop over grooming one spot.
 
Hmm, that's an interesting issue. Any chance she has mites / lice causing extra itching? Could you use some Vetrycin or something similar to see if that would sooth her skin without being greasy?
 
Hmm, that's an interesting issue. Any chance she has mites / lice causing extra itching? Could you use some Vetrycin or something similar to see if that would sooth her skin without being greasy?
I thought that but she's the only one who has this issue and I haven't seen any bugs when checking her out. Her skin doesn't look irritated or damaged, just featherless. I noticed a spot on her chest to, but no damage or signs of skin discomfort
